В конструкции отсутствуют подвижные части, сложные узлы и детали. 2 ил.The invention relates to the field of purification and aeration of water and is intended for aeration of rivers. The purpose of the invention is to increase the efficiency of aeration, to simplify the construction, by achieving the aerator being made in the form of the main floating base 1 formed by two wings facing each other with their convex sides. The air intakes 2 communicate with their cavities with the narrowest space between the wings. When placed in the water flow between the edges, a vacuum is created, due to which air is sucked through the air inlet 2, and the water is enriched with atmospheric oxygen. The design has no moving parts, complex components and parts. 2 Il.
